Transaction 5523c31bb3b89a196fdbc3ccbf99212e7748a08f22204d2d424e2f757fc7fa12

2 Input
1 Outputs
  • 5523c31bb3b89a196fdbc3ccbf99212e7748a08f22204d2d424e2f757fc7fa12:0
  • value  475157
    address  1FGKGvUut528hHuGA4eXrjetYcT3hcvyWw